HB 2278·KS·house

Increasing the extent of property tax exemption from the statewide school levy for residential property.

FailedFiled Feb 5, 2025
Sponsor: Brandon Woodard (D)
Latest Action

Died in Committee

Apr 10, 2026

Summary

The bill would increase the portion of a home’s appraised value that is exempt from the statewide school levy, starting at $75,000 and rising to $110,000. After 2027, the exemption amount would be adjusted each year based on the average change in residential property values across the state, but it could never decrease. The goal is to lessen the school‑tax burden on homeowners.
